River Forest is noted for its many elegant houses designed and constructed at the turn of the century by, among others, Frank Lloyd Wright. River Forest offers the perfect balance between urban and suburban lifestyles.

The Village of River Forest was incorporated on October 24, 1880. River Forest's population hit its peak of 13,402 in 1970 and has remained fairly constant since then. As of the 2000 census, River Forest had a population of 11,635.

River Forest Township is bounded by Harlem Avenue, North Avenue, Madison Avenue to Lathrop Avenue, to Central Avenue and back to Harlem.

The Village of River Forest is located in western Cook County's western border along the eastern bank of the Des Plaines River.
